HPC-Skills

Build, debug, and run HPC simulation workflows on clusters

Generates, reviews, and repairs simulation inputs for OpenFOAM, LAMMPS, VASP, Quantum ESPRESSO, GROMACS, FEniCS, LS-DYNA, and other HPC codes. Eliminates guesswork in MPI launch, GPU mapping, compiler toolchains, Spack stacks, and Slurm job submission. Provides error-pattern dictionaries, starter templates, and cluster playbooks so simulations converge and run correctly the first time.

How to install HPC-Skills?โ–ผ

Run `npx skills add SciMate-AI/HPC-Skills --all -g -y` in your terminal to install all HPC skills globally.

Which simulation software does HPC-Skills cover?โ–ผ

It covers OpenFOAM, SU2, LS-DYNA, FEniCS, CalculiX, ElmerFEM, PETSc, hypre, Trilinos, LAMMPS, GROMACS, Quantum ESPRESSO, VASP, Gaussian, ParaView, and Gmsh, plus MPI, GPU, Spack, and cluster orchestration.

Can it fix failing Slurm or MPI jobs?โ–ผ

Yes. The MPI, GPU, and orchestration skills include error-pattern dictionaries and playbooks for launcher mismatches, rank binding, scheduler integration, and quota or module failures.

Does HPC-Skills work with Claude Code and Codex?โ–ผ

Yes. Each skill follows the standard SKILL.md layout and can be loaded by Claude Code, Codex, and other agents that read skill folders.

Do I need HPC experience to use these skills?โ–ผ

Basic cluster familiarity helps, but the skills encode expert rules for solver selection, convergence, and job submission so the agent handles the technical details from plain-English requests.
